A continental crossbow
German or Swiss, late 18th century

The 20 inch steel bow, missing the string, the binding cords set with wool pom poms. Walnut butt of gun stock form and with oval cheekpiece; the tip set with an iron stirrup; covered bolt channel lined in bone, the top fitted with simple rear sight, the bone front sight broken.
Condition: Bow with dark age patina. Stock with numerous light marks.
